Find Your Vintage Style
Before you start decorating, decide what type of vintage aesthetic speaks to you. Some people love mid-century modern furniture with sleek lines and warm wood tones, while others prefer ornate Victorian pieces with intricate carvings. You can also mix styles throughout your home for a more layered and curated look. The beauty of vintage decor is that there are no rules—just your creativity and personal taste!

Decorate with Thrifted & Upcycled Items
Thrifting and upcycling are fantastic ways to achieve a vintage look without spending a fortune. Here are some ideas:
-
Repurpose Old Frames – Turn them into decorative chalkboards or vintage-inspired art displays.
-
Use Antique Linens – Drape vintage linens over tables, chairs, or hang them as curtains for a soft, nostalgic touch.
-
Mix and Match China – Create an elegant table setting with mismatched vintage plates and teacups.
-
Revamp Old Furniture – A simple coat of paint and new hardware can transform an old dresser or side table into a charming vintage statement piece.
Layer Your Space for a Collected Look
Vintage decor shines when layered thoughtfully. Mix and match textures, patterns, and materials to create a warm and inviting atmosphere. Combine aged wood with delicate porcelain, layer vintage textiles over modern furniture, and mix different eras for a well-curated space that feels lived-in and cozy.
